A member asked:

Does vit d deficiency cause tingling/numbness,limb weakness,low chronic fever,headaches,pain,severe memory loss,ataxia,etc?initial vit d level was 5.

Dr. Eric Weisman answered

Specializes in Neurology

Severe memory loss: with ataxia can be seen with B12 deficiency. This can also cause neuropathy in addition to brain and spinal cord degeneration. Vit D deficiency may contribute to memory loss. Fever....probably not.
